PowerStop AR84002EVC Disc Brake Rotor - Rear
Power Stop Rear Genuine Geomet Coated Rotor Overview
The Power Stop - Rear Genuine Geomet Coated Rotor (Part Number AR84002EVC) is engineered for reliable braking performance and corrosion resistance. Designed as a solid disc brake rotor, it features a durable Geomet coating to protect against rust and extend rotor life.
- Part Number: AR84002EVC
- Type: Solid Disc Brake Rotor
- Rust Resistant Geomet Coating
- Outside Diameter: 12.80 inches (324.00 mm)
- Nominal Thickness: 0.47 inches (12.00 mm)
- Discard Thickness: 0.41 inches (10.50 mm)
- Overall Height: 1.40 inches (36.50 mm)
- Mounting Bolt Hole Circle Diameter: 4.50 inches (115.00 mm)
- Stud/Lug Hole Quantity: 6

Installation Notes and Tips
Ensure the rotor is compatible with your vehicle’s rear axle specifications, including bolt pattern and rotor dimensions. Clean the hub surface before installation to prevent runout. Use proper torque specifications on lug nuts to avoid rotor warping. It is recommended to replace brake pads when installing new rotors to optimize braking performance.
